Developing and programming a watershed traversal algorithm (WTA) in GRID-DEM and adapting it to hydrological processes
چکیده انگلیسی

A methodology for programming hydrological processes into watersheds using grid-type digital elevation models (DEMs) is investigated. This methodology is based on the basic configuration of the flow directions structure in the DEM, which is stored in files where information about topological relations and other frequently used features are saved. Some basic functions for managing topological data that significantly simplify the source code programming are also presented and described. We develop an algorithm that runs the entire drainage network in a watershed in both directions, upwards and downwards, which is ideal for incorporating structural models of hydrological processes that occur in basins or assessing its characteristics. The main attribute of this method is that information about hydrological processes and properties is transmitted during the routing from one area to another of the basin. The information is used when developing models of these hydrological processes and transmitted throughout the basin. At the end of the article, using this methodology with the SHEE software is illustrated with some examples.
